However, even with this setback, the data clearly reflects the safety impact of seat belt use. In 2000, only 70.7% of front seat passengers were observed using seat belts, and 60.2% of occupant deaths were unrestrained. The 2022 data show that seat belt use is at 91.6%, and unrestrained occupant deaths currently account for 49.8% of deaths.

(KS Statutes Ch. 8, Article 25) Child passenger safety; restraining systems for children under the age of four; use of seat belts by children between the ages of five and fourteen.Green belt was designed for traffic heat mitigation and carbon neutrality. • Urban traffic coupling source method was proposed to model moving vehicle rapidly. • Placing trees and shrubs near non-motorized area can reduce temperature of 1.05 °C. • Tree spacing of 0–0.38 W and shrub length of 0.17–0.63 L showed great co-benefits.Dec 17, 2017 · The Belt Parkway name is used overall along the Shore, Southern and Laurelton Parkway segments through Brooklyn and south Queens. Cross Island Parkway remains the primary name along its segment. Each section retained its unique name until the 1970s. 1. For a time 15.6 miles of Belt Parkway were considered for inclusion in the Interstate system.

Highlights of NYS's occupant restraint law: In the front seat, the driver and each passenger must wear a seat belt, one person per belt. The driver and front-seat passengers aged 16 or older can be fined up to $50 each for failure to buckle up. Approximately 1.19 million people die each year as a result of road traffic crashes. Check out the current traffic and highway conditions on Belt Pkwy @ Rockaway Parkway in New York City, NY.Abstract. For nearly a decade it has been commonly assumed that seat belt laws save lives. Using traffic fatality data from 1983 through 1993 this paper offers evidence to call this assumption into question. For several years traffic fatality rates have been declining in roughly equal proportions in both law states and non-law states.Safety belts, use required. —. Penalties. —. Exemptions. There was a very highly significant negative correlation between the seatbelt compliance and road traffic death rates (R = - 0.77, F = 65.5, p < 0.00001).
